Some people are born with a perfect rectus abdominis, which is a paired muscle that runs vertically on the abdomen. So, if you have three connective tissue bands, you have a six pack. If you have four connective tissue bands running across the parallel muscles, you have an 8-pack. Some people have five connective tissue bands running across their abdomen. Hence, the pack.
And for some people their abdominal structure might even allow for 12 pack abs to form. You might spend a good part of your life doing crunches and oblique exercises. But if you still do not have a visible ten pack, point to the sky and blame genetics. You have to be born with them. If you are not genetically born with a six-pack, a cosmetic abdominal surgery might be one way to get it. Not all procedures are cut from the same cloth. Your body fat levels, your current abdominal muscle conditioning and the amount of money you are willing to spend, everything matters. Liposuction is the most common of them all.
In simple terms, it is surgery performed to remove excess fat and contour the body. When performed on the midsection, it is typically done to improve aesthetics or enhance the visibility of the abs. It is known by several terms, such as lipo, lipoplasty, body contouring or abdominal etching. While it may improve the appearance of your abs, ab etching will not get you a pack if you do not have the separations to begin with.
However, if you have the pack separations and is covered by a layer of fat which you are too lazy to burn off with diet and exercise , ab etching is your ticket. Ab implants is a procedure where silicone implants are surgically inserted into your abdominal region to create the perfect 6, 8 or pack.
Believe it or not, some people are unfortunate enough to be born without the rectus abdominus. Ab implants are generally used to create the 6-pack that they lack. However, if you have the 6-pack to begin with, then ab implants can help you extend the appearance of the muscle, giving you an 8 or a pack. Unlike liposuction, which is a minimally invasive procedure, ab implants are a surgical procedure performed under general anesthesia.

Of course, that depends on how much body fat you carry. Do ab exercises at least thrice a week. Work on your upper abs, the lower abs and the obliques.
If you have gained the strength needed to do rep sets, then try adding weights to them. This will help you develop strong ab muscles, which will be visible even if you are at a reasonably low body fat percentage. You have to drop body fat. And the only way to do it is to burn more calories than what you consume. Start calculating your total calorie intake. Then calculate your Total Daily Energy Expenditure to know how many calories you need to maintain your current weight. Then reduce calories from this to start eating in a deficit.
Add cardio to this and you should be able to drop body fat a lot sooner. No matter what you hear or read on the internet, there is no spot reduction. You will have to lose fat from everywhere to lose it from your belly. You can use body fat calculators found online to get a ballpark figure of your body fat. But for an accurate measurement, you need body fat calipers, or you need a dexa scan. But get an accurate measurement to know how much more fat you need to drop to make those ab muscles visible.

Exercises that require you to move your body against resistance help build muscle strength, tone, and endurance. Exercise machines and enhancements, such as weights and body bands, all provide resistance.
So do many water exercises. HIIT refers to short, one- to two-minute bursts of high-intensity cardio followed by a rest period of equal time. To be effective, each burst of cardio must be done at your very top capacity. Because your body is working at its highest capacity, HIIT sessions burn lots of calories both during workouts and for several hours afterward.
